What it doesSummary introduced in house (Jul 23, 2014)
Competitive Service Act of 2014 - Authorizes an appointing authority (i.e., a federal agency appointing an individual to a position in the competitive service) other than the appointing authority that requested the certificate of eligibles for filling a position in the competitive service to select an individual from that certificate for appointment to a position that is: (1) in the same occupational series as the position for which the certification of eligibles was issued, and (2) at a similar grade level as the original position.
